Transaction 215951d290399eee7b17c33aba62c976a41ae304c64a86ed55c1f86a2e9a8f16
1 Input
1 Output
-
215951d290399eee7b17c33aba62c976a41ae304c64a86ed55c1f86a2e9a8f16:0
- value
- 282462
- script pubkey
- OP_0 OP_PUSHBYTES_32 3754be05204f08331b010a635d9153f4c1ff067c2f962844cff316584bbbfac3
- address
- bc1qxa2tupfqfuyrxxcppf34my2n7nql7pnu97tzs3x07vt9sjamltpsyh64wc